Knut Klotz (born July 5, 1944 in Zwickau ) is a German politician ( SPD ).

Knut Klotz attended the Polytechnic High School (POS) " Friedrich Schiller " in Zwickau- Oberplanitz and then did an apprenticeship as an electrician . In 1967 he became an engineer for electrical systems construction. He later studied at the Humboldt University in Berlin and graduated in 1976 with a degree in law.

In the course of the change in the GDR , Klotz joined the Social Democratic Party (SDP) in 1990 . In the first free East Berlin election in May 1990 , he was elected to the Berlin city council. Even in the joint election in December 1990 , he was able to win the direct mandate in constituency 1 in the Treptow district . In 1995, Klotz left parliament.
